Letters from Father Christmas is a collection of Tolkien’s letters to his four children at Christmas. The letters told wonderful stories about Father Christmas’s life and adventures at the North pole. Tolkien wrote these letters because he wanted to keep Father Christmas alive for his four children. Letters from Father Christmas It is a collection of letters written and illustrated by J.R.R. Tolkien. After the birth of his firstborn son, Tolkien began to write his children letters from Father Christmas. Edited by Baillie Tolkien, the second wife of his youngest son, the letters were released on 2 Sept. 1976, the third anniversary of Tolkien’s death. The book was warmly received by critics. The letters were also beautifully illustrated- each must have taken its true author, Tolkien, a long time to complete. must have +过去分词 表示对过去相当肯定 的推测, 意为“一定已经” 它的否定为 can’t /couldn’t have done 意为 “过去一定不可能” eg The ground is wet, it must have rained last night. 地面很湿,昨晚一定下过雨。 5.
